Barbo's WW Crockpot Spicy Apple Tapioca Dessert*
6 servings
1 point each made with Splenda
6 large Gala apples peeled, cored, sliced or coarsely chopped
1 c. Splenda
2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on salt
3 tablespoons Minute Tapioca (leave out for CORE)
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 tbs. vanilla
1 cup boiling water
Mix sliced apples with sugar, cinnamon, salt and tapioca until evenly
coated. Put mixture in crockpot. Pour lemon juice over apples and
THEN add boiling water. Cook on high for about an hour.
6 servings using all Splenda @ 1 Point {72 calories, 2.8 grams fiber, 0.3 grams fat}
